3 Ways to Protect Yourself from Manipulators and Sociopaths: Recognize Your Weaknesses Before They Exploit Them!

Millions of people around us are actually skilled manipulators with serious personality disorders such as antisocial personality disorder, including narcissistic and psychopathic ones. They are not fictional characters, they are real, and can be very difficult to recognize at first.
According to Your Tango, statistics show the prevalence of this disorder is about 2-4% in men and 0.5-1% in women. They do not see social interactions as equal, but as a field for preying.
For them, you have something they can use, and they will manipulate your weakness to get it.
Then, how can one protect oneself from people like this? The key lies in self-awareness.
Here are three ways to become a person who is not easily targeted by sociopaths:
1. Recognize Your Weaknesses Before Others Realize Them
Are you feeling lonely? Overwhelmed by family matters? Or under financial pressure? All of these are vulnerabilities that can be an entry point for a manipulator to get in and take advantage of you.
The first step is self-reflection. Take some time with a pen and paper, then ask yourself, "What do I want? How much do I want it?"
Note down everything that comes up. This will help you recognize desires that can be used as weapons by those with ill intentions.
The more you feel hopeless about something, such as feeling meaningless without a partner, the greater the risk of becoming an easy target for manipulative people.
2. If Your Weak Point Comes from a Old Wound, Then Heal It
We have all certainly experienced disappointment, loss, or even betrayal. Emotional wounds like these create a vulnerable energy that can be sensed very quickly by sociopaths.
The best way to protect yourself is to heal that wound. Let yourself feel sad, angry, or disappointed, because by feeling it, you can let it go.
This process is not easy and can be painful. Do it yourself in a safe space or with a therapist you trust. But believe me, the result is worth it.
When old wounds heal, you will become a stronger person and harder to take advantage of.
3. When You Start Being Approached, Listen to Your Intuition
Beware if someone comes and feels like the answer to all your prayers. They might be targeting your weakness.
Trust your instincts. If an uncomfortable feeling arises, even without a logical reason, believe in that feeling. Don't wait for proof of manipulation or betrayal to act. Indeed, intuition is the earliest alarm before everything becomes clear.
Any relationship, especially a romantic one, requires vulnerability. We open ourselves up, take risks, and hope for the best. But with strong self-awareness and emotional protection, you can distinguish who deserves your trust and who is dangerous.
Knowing that manipulation can happen, and knowing yourself is the key to staying safe when opening your heart.
Protecting yourself from sociopaths is not about being closed off or suspicious of everyone. It's about recognizing and healing your own wounds, and trusting your intuition. In this way, you will become a strong, aware, and not easily manipulated person.
